1. Understanding Territory Basics

Before you can upgrade, you need to understand the basics of territory management. You claim territory by placing a Territory Core. This core defines the boundaries of your claim and serves as the central hub for all your territory-related activities. Remember these key points:

  • Territory Size: The initial territory size is limited. Upgrading your territory expands this area, giving you more room to build and defend.
  • Territory Cores: You can only have one active Territory Core at a time. If you want to move your base, you'll need to dismantle your existing Core and rebuild it elsewhere.
  • Territory Level: This determines the maximum level of structures you can build within your territory, the resources you can generate, and the defenses you can deploy.
  • Territory Resources: Certain resources are required to upgrade your territory. These resources become increasingly scarce as you progress, so efficient resource management is essential.

2. Gathering Resources for Upgrades

Upgrading your territory requires specific resources. The exact resources needed will vary depending on the level you're upgrading to, but common requirements include:

  • Metal: Obtained by mining ore deposits found throughout the world. Focus on areas with higher concentrations of metal ore.
  • Wood: Harvested from trees. Prioritize forests and wooded areas for efficient wood collection.
  • Stone: Mined from rock formations and boulders. Look for stone deposits near mountains and cliffs.
  • Polymer: Often crafted from refined oil or other processed materials. Requires advanced crafting stations.
  • Specialized Components: These are rarer resources found in specific locations, such as abandoned settlements, military outposts, or aberrant nests. Pay attention to world events and explore thoroughly to find them.

3. Accessing the Territory Upgrade Menu

To initiate the upgrade process, interact with your Territory Core. This will open the territory management menu. Within this menu, you'll find an option to "Upgrade Territory." Select this option to view the requirements for the next upgrade level.

The menu will display:

  • Current Territory Level: Shows your current territory level.
  • Next Territory Level: Indicates the level you'll achieve upon upgrading.
  • Resource Requirements: Lists the specific resources needed for the upgrade.
  • Upgrade Button: Activates the upgrade process once all requirements are met.

4. Meeting the Upgrade Requirements

This is the most crucial step. Ensure you have all the required resources in your inventory or stored within your territory's storage containers. The game will automatically detect the resources if they are within your territory's storage range. Double-check the quantities to avoid any frustrating last-minute scrambles.

5. Initiating and Completing the Upgrade

Once you've confirmed that you have all the necessary resources, click the "Upgrade" button. The upgrade process will begin, and a timer will appear. During this time, your Territory Core will be vulnerable, so ensure you have adequate defenses in place.

Defense Considerations:

  • Turrets: Place turrets strategically around your Territory Core to deter attackers.
  • Walls and Barriers: Fortify your territory with walls and barriers to slow down enemies.
  • Traps: Utilize traps to inflict damage and disrupt enemy movements.
  • Allies: Coordinate with other players to defend your territory during the upgrade process.

Once the timer reaches zero, the upgrade will be complete, and your territory will be at the next level. You'll immediately gain access to the benefits associated with the new level, such as increased building limits, improved resource generation, and access to advanced crafting recipes.
